The formula of LCM is LCM(a,b) = ( a × b) / GCF(a,b).
We need to calculate greatest common factor 972 and 978, than apply into the LCM equation.
GCF(972,978) = 6
LCM(972,978) = ( 972 × 978) / 6
LCM(972,978) = 950616 / 6
LCM(972,978) = 158436

5. How to Find the LCM of 972 and 978?Answer:
Least Common Multiple of 972 and 978 = 158436
Step 1: Find the prime factorization of 972
972 = 2 x 2 x 3 x 3 x 3 x 3 x 3
Step 2: Find the prime factorization of 978
978 = 2 x 3 x 163
Step 3: Multiply each factor the greater number of times it occurs in steps i) or ii) above to find the lcm:
LCM = 158436 = 2 x 2 x 3 x 3 x 3 x 3 x 3 x 163
Step 4: Therefore, the least common multiple of 972 and 978 is 158436.
